ComponentRuntimeMBean
, javax.management.DynamicMBean
, javax.management.MBeanRegistration
, javax.management.NotificationBroadcaster
, RuntimeMBean
, WebLogicMBean
public interface JDBCReplayStatisticsRuntimeMBean extends ComponentRuntimeMBean
ACTIVATED, NEW, PREPARED, UNPREPARED
Modifier and Type | Method | Description |
---|---|---|
void |
clearStatistics() |
Clear the statistics on all connections.
|
long |
getFailedReplayCount() |
Obtains the number of replays that failed.
|
long |
getReplayDisablingCount() |
Obtains the number of times that replay is disabled.
|
long |
getSuccessfulReplayCount() |
Obtains the number of replays that succeeded.
|
long |
getTotalCalls() |
Obtains the total number of JDBC calls executed so far.
|
long |
getTotalCallsAffectedByOutages() |
Obtains the number of JDBC calls affected by outages.
|
long |
getTotalCallsAffectedByOutagesDuringReplay() |
Obtains the number of JDBC calls affected by outages in the
middle of replay.
|
long |
getTotalCallsTriggeringReplay() |
Obtains the number of JDBC calls that triggered replay.
|
long |
getTotalCompletedRequests() |
Obtains the total number of completed requests so far.
|
long |
getTotalProtectedCalls() |
Obtains the total number of JDBC calls executed so far that
are protected by AC.
|
long |
getTotalReplayAttempts() |
Obtains the number of replay attempts.
|
long |
getTotalRequests() |
Obtains the total number of successfully submitted requests so far.
|
void |
refreshStatistics() |
Update the snapshot
|
getDeploymentState, getModuleId, getWorkManagerRuntimes
getAttribute, getAttributes, invoke, setAttribute, setAttributes
postDeregister, postRegister, preRegister
addNotificationListener, getNotificationInfo, removeNotificationListener
addPropertyChangeListener, removePropertyChangeListener
getMBeanInfo, getName, getObjectName, getParent, getType, isCachingDisabled, isRegistered, setName, setParent
void refreshStatistics()
void clearStatistics()
long getTotalRequests()
long getTotalCompletedRequests()
long getTotalCalls()
long getTotalProtectedCalls()
long getTotalCallsAffectedByOutages()
long getTotalCallsTriggeringReplay()
long getTotalCallsAffectedByOutagesDuringReplay()
long getSuccessfulReplayCount()
long getFailedReplayCount()
Obtains the number of replays that failed.
When replay fails, it rethrows the original SQLRecoverableException
to the application, with the reason for the failure chained to
that original exception. Application can call getNextException
to retrieve the reason.
long getReplayDisablingCount()
long getTotalReplayAttempts()